机器人基本概念
更新时间:2022-05-20
什么是机器人?
机器人是在业务系统中与用户直接对话的模块,每个机器人都可以为用户提供多项服务。比如,小度音箱就是一个机器人,它可以为用户提供订车票,听音乐等多项服务。
什么是技能?
技能是机器人为用户在特定场景下提供专项服务的内在能力。比如小度音箱中,订车票、听音乐服务就是两个技能。
机器人和技能有什么关系?
机器人对技能统一调度管理,从而为用户提供多项对话服务。UNIT为开发者提供了两种对话流管理方式:技能分发对话流管理和图形化对话流管理。
技能分发对话流管理为开发者提供了便捷的对话中控服务,仅需将技能添加到机器人中,机器人即可自动将用户对话分发给对应的技能进行回复。
适用于对话流程短,主要依靠不同的技能回复用户问题的对话场景。当您的业务需求仅需一两轮对话就能解决时,建议使用。
图形化对话流管理为开发者提供了图形化对话流编辑器,开发者可根据业务需求精准配置每一步对话流程。同时,除了可视化的配置页面外,图形化对话流管理还支持自定义编程,有效支持各种复杂对话场景。
适用于对话流程长,分支多的对话场景。当您的业务需求需要进行多轮对话才能解决时,建议使用。
机器人数据配额
为便于更好的使用UNIT,专门为大家整理了UNIT中各单位的数量与格式限制文档,点击查看。